Martina McBride is known for her love of both good food and cooking. The singer likes to make meals for her family and to entertain, as well. Also, in her free time, one of her favorite things to do is sit down with a cup of coffee and read cookbooks.

McBride recently gave PEOPLE a look into her Nashville kitchen, which is done in beige, cream and granite. It has traditional stainless steel appliances mixed with antiques, glassware and old signs. The kitchen sits right next to the family room, and that was done on purpose so that everyone can hang out there together. McBride says, "I like the fact that it's part family room and part kitchen. I don't feel like I'm stuck alone cooking while everybody is somewhere else."

The country star takes great pleasure in a tradition her family has, eating together at the dinner table. Her husband John and daughters Delaney, Emma and Ava are often guinea pigs for the new recipes she tries. Teaching her young daughters how to eat healthy is something she finds essential.

Her favorite recipes include jambalaya, meatloaf and mashed potatoes, but her signature dish is fried chicken. When asked how she always stays so skinny, McBride reveals, "It's just good genes. My brother's so skinny I can barely fit into his jeans!"

The country singer likes to share her recipes with fans as well, like peach cobbler and white chili. She recently let TV host Rachael Ray take a look inside her fridge, which includes a lot of dairy products (she proudly says she also knows how to milk a cow), a box of baking soda to catch odors and various chocolate sauces, since her husband John is a "chocoholic."

If she had not been a singer, McBride had another profession in mind. She tells The Boot, "I love to plan parties and cook, and if I didn't do this, I'd probably be a caterer or party planner." What is really important to her is that her fridge is "a family fridge, so there's a little of something everybody likes in there."
